Browsers provide readable defaults for all the elements, and then users … WebThe unset CSS keyword resets a property to its inherited value if it inherits from its parent, and to its initial value if not. In other words, it behaves like the inherit keyword in the first case, and like the initial keyword in the second case. WebInheritance. In CSS, inheritance controls what happens when no value is specified for a property on an element. inherited properties, which by default are set to the computed value of the parent element. non-inherited properties, which by default are set to initial value of the property.
